Abrahams says ANC needs to do more for small businesses
Updated | By Makhosazane Twala
Minister of Small Business Development, Stella Ndabeni Abrahams says the ANC’s July policy conference discussed how small and medium enterprises can play a leading role in driving economic growth.

Ndadeni Abrahams was addressing a Progressive Business Forum breakfast on the sidelines of the ANC national at Nasrec on Monday.
Ndadeni Abrahams acknowledged that the ANC policies downplay the role of small businesses in South Africa.
“I think the role of small businesses is really underplayed in our policy as the ANC, and consequently, in the government policy and budget allocation.
“As a small business portfolio, we are looking forward to this ANC 55th conference so that we can jump to this and correct it as we share with businesspeople of our country,” she said.
“We are growing too slowly, and unemployment is too high and large corporates will not provide the jobs we need as a country South Africa remains as one of the most unequal countries globally.”
